

Table of Contents
- Introduction: The Evolving Landscape of Network Penetration Testing
- Understanding the Importance of Information Gathering
- Passive Information Gathering: Leveraging Open-Source Intelligence (OSINT)
- Active Information Gathering: Probing the Target Network
- Social Engineering: The Human Element of Information Gathering
- Leveraging Automated Tools for Efficient Information Gathering
- Analyzing and Correlating Information for Actionable Insights
- **The Role of Education: Ethical Hacking Course in Pune
- Ethical Considerations in Information Gathering
- Conclusion: Embracing a Comprehensive Approach to Network Penetration Testing
Introduction: The Evolving Landscape of Network Penetration Testing
In the ever-changing world of cybersecurity, network penetration testing has become a critical component of an organization's defense strategy. As attackers continue to develop sophisticated techniques to breach networks, penetration testers must stay one step ahead by employing advanced information gathering methods. Beyond the traditional footprinting techniques, today's penetration testers must leverage a wide array of tools and strategies to uncover hidden vulnerabilities and potential attack vectors.This article will explore the world of advanced information gathering techniques, delving into the various methods and tools that can be used to gather comprehensive intelligence about a target network. By understanding the importance of information gathering and mastering the techniques discussed in this article, penetration testers can enhance their ability to identify and mitigate risks, ultimately strengthening an organization's overall security posture.
Understanding the Importance of Information Gathering
Information gathering is the foundation upon which successful network penetration testing is built. By collecting and analyzing data about a target network, penetration testers can gain valuable insights into the organization's security posture, potential vulnerabilities, and attack surfaces. This information is then used to develop and execute targeted attack strategies, ultimately helping to identify and address weaknesses before they can be exploited by malicious actors. However, information gathering is not a one-size-fits-all process. Depending on the scope and objectives of the penetration test, different techniques and tools may be employed to gather the necessary intelligence. Passive information-gathering methods, such as Open-Source Intelligence (OSINT), can provide a wealth of information without directly interacting with the target network, while active techniques, such as port scanning and vulnerability analysis, offer a more comprehensive view of the network's security posture. Passive Information Gathering: Leveraging Open-Source Intelligence (OSINT)
Open-source intelligence (OSINT) is a powerful tool in the arsenal of the modern penetration tester. By leveraging publicly available information from various sources, such as social media, websites, and online forums, OSINT can provide valuable insights into an organization's structure, personnel, and potential vulnerabilities. One of the key advantages of OSINT is its ability to gather information without directly interacting with the target network, reducing the risk of detection and minimizing the potential impact on network operations. OSINT techniques can include searching for employee information on social media platforms, analyzing domain registration data, and identifying potential attack vectors based on publicly available information. By combining OSINT with other information-gathering methods, penetration testers can build a comprehensive understanding of the target network, enabling them to develop more effective attack strategies and identify potential vulnerabilities that may have been overlooked by traditional footprinting techniques.
Active Information Gathering: Probing the Target Network
While passive informatiinformation-gatheringon gathering techniques can provide a wealth of information, active probing of the target network is often necessary to gain a more comprehensive understanding of its security posture. Active information gathering involves directly interacting with the network, using techniques such as port scanning, vulnerability analysis, and network mapping to identify potential attack vectors and vulnerabilities.One of the most commonly used active information gathering techniques is port scanning, which involves identifying open ports and associated services on target systems. By analyzing the results of port scans, penetration testers can gain insights into the software and services running on the network, as well as potential vulnerabilities that may be present. Another important active information-gathering technique is vulnerability analysis, which involves using specialized tools to identify known vulnerabilities in network devices and systems. By combining the results of port scans and vulnerability analysis, penetration testers can develop a more complete picture of the target network's security posture and identify potential attack vectors.
Social Engineering: The Human Element of Information Gathering
While technical information-gathering techniques are essential, the human element of information-gathering cannot be overlooked. Social engineering, the art of manipulating people into divulging sensitive information or performing actions that compromise security, is a powerful tool in the hands of a skilled penetration tester. Social engineering techniques can include phishing attacks, pretexting (creating a plausible scenario to gain trust), and physical security testing (testing the security of physical access points). By leveraging social engineering, penetration testers can gather information that may not be readily available through technical means, such as login credentials, network diagrams, and sensitive documents. However, it is important to note that social engineering techniques must be used with caution and with the full knowledge and consent of the target organization. Penetration testers must adhere to strict ethical guidelines and ensure that their actions do not cause harm or violate the trust of the organization being tested. Leveraging Automated Tools for Efficient Information Gathering
In today's fast-paced cybersecurity landscape, manual information-gathering techniques can be time-consuming and inefficient. Automated tools, such as vulnerability scanners and network mapping software, can help penetration testers gather information more quickly and efficiently, freeing up time for analysis and attack strategy development. One of the most widely used automated information-gathering tools is Nmap (Network Mapper), a free and open-source utility for network discovery and security auditing. Nmap can be used to perform port scans, OS detection, and version scanning, providing penetration testers with a wealth of information about the target network. Another useful automated tool is Maltego, a powerful open-source intelligence and forensics application that can be used to gather and analyze information from various online sources. Maltego can be used to map relationships between people, organizations, and digital artifacts, providing penetration testers with a comprehensive view of the target network's attack surface. Analyzing and Correlating Information for Actionable Insights
Once the information-gathering process is complete, penetration testers must analyze and correlate the gathered data to identify potential vulnerabilities and develop effective attack strategies. This process involves identifying patterns, correlating information from multiple sources, and prioritizing potential attack vectors based on their likelihood of success and potential impact. One of the key challenges in this phase is separating relevant information from noise. With the vast amount of data gathered during the information-gathering process, it can be easy to become overwhelmed or distracted by irrelevant information. Penetration testers must develop strong analytical skills and the ability to quickly identify and prioritize the most critical pieces of information. By leveraging data analysis techniques and tools, such as spreadsheets, databases, and visualization software, penetration testers can gain a clearer picture of the target network's security posture and identify potential attack vectors. This information can then be used to develop targeted attack strategies and prioritize remediation efforts, ultimately helping to strengthen the organization's overall security posture.
The Role of Education: Ethical Hacking Course in Pune
- As the field of network penetration testing continues to evolve, education will play a critical role in preparing the next generation of cybersecurity professionals to master advanced information-gathering techniques. An Ethical Hacking course in Pune can provide aspiring penetration testers with the knowledge and skills needed to navigate the complexities of information gathering and develop effective attack strategies. These courses often cover topics such as: OSINT and passive information-gathering techniques: Students learn how to leverage publicly available information to gather intelligence about target networks and organizations.
- Active information gathering methods: Courses provide hands-on training in techniques such as port scanning, vulnerability analysis, and network mapping.
- Social engineering principles and best practices: Students explore the human element of information gathering and learn how to conduct social engineering attacks ethically and responsibly.
- Data analysis and correlation techniques: Courses emphasize the importance of analyzing and correlating gathered information to identify potential vulnerabilities and develop effective attack strategies.
By equipping students with a solid foundation in these areas, ethical hacking courses can help prepare the next generation of penetration testers to excel in the field and contribute to the ongoing fight against cyber threats. Ethical Considerations in Information Gathering
While information gathering is a critical component of network penetration testing, it is essential to conduct these activities ethically and responsibly. Penetration testers must adhere to strict guidelines and obtain explicit permission from the target organization before engaging in any information-gathering or attack activities. One of the key ethical considerations in information gathering is the protection of sensitive data. Penetration testers may come across sensitive information during their work, such as login credentials, financial data, or personal information. It is essential that this information is handled with the utmost care and discretion, and that it is not shared or used for any purpose other than the penetration test itself. Another important ethical consideration is the potential impact of information-gathering activities on network operations. While penetration testers strive to minimize disruption, some information-gathering techniques, such as port scanning or vulnerability analysis, may have unintended consequences on network performance or availability. Penetration testers must be aware of these potential impacts and take steps to mitigate them where possible. By prioritizing ethical considerations and adhering to best practices, penetration testers can ensure that their information-gathering activities are conducted responsibly and professionally, ultimately strengthening the organization's security posture without causing harm or violating trust.
Conclusion: Embracing a Comprehensive Approach to Network Penetration Testing
In today's rapidly evolving cybersecurity landscape, network penetration testing has become an essential component of an organization's defense strategy. By leveraging advanced information-gathering techniques, penetration testers can uncover hidden vulnerabilities and potential attack vectors, enabling organizations to proactively address security risks before they can be exploited by malicious actors. From passive information-gathering techniques such as OSINT to active probing methods and social engineering, penetration testers must master a wide array of tools and strategies to gather comprehensive intelligence about target networks. By combining these techniques with data analysis and correlation skills, penetration testers can develop effective attack strategies and prioritize remediation efforts, ultimately strengthening the organization's overall security posture. As the demand for skilled cybersecurity professionals continues to grow, education will play a critical role in preparing the next generation of penetration testers to excel in the field.
An Ethical Hacking course in Pune can provide aspiring professionals with the knowledge and skills needed to navigate the complexities of information gathering and develop effective attack strategies while emphasizing the importance of ethical and responsible conduct. In conclusion, embracing a comprehensive approach to network penetration testing, grounded in advanced information-gathering techniques and ethical best practices, is essential for organizations seeking to protect their networks and data from cyber threats. By investing in education and staying informed about the latest trends and techniques in penetration testing, organizations can build resilient security frameworks that safeguard their critical assets and maintain a competitive edge in an increasingly digital landscape.





